Lovable Setup
Connect Nexlayer to Lovable, the AI-powered app builder.
Custom MCP Servers
Custom MCP servers (like Nexlayer) are available on Lovable paid plans. Prebuilt connectors (Notion, Linear, Jira, etc.) are available on all plans.
Add Nexlayer to Lovable
Lovable manages MCP servers through the Settings UI. Follow these steps to connect Nexlayer:
- 1
Open Lovable Settings
Navigate to Settings → Connectors → Personal connectors
- 2
Add New MCP Server
Click New MCP server to add a custom connector
- 3
Enter Server Details
Server Name
NexlayerServer URL
https://mcp.nexlayer.ai/api/mcpAuthentication
OAuth (default) - 4
Authorize Connection
Click Add & authorize and complete the Nexlayer authentication
What You Can Do
Once connected, Lovable's AI agent can use Nexlayer to:
Deploy your app
Build and deploy directly from Lovable
Check deployment status
View health and availability
View logs
Stream real-time application logs
Manage domains
Configure custom domains
Security & Management
Personal connectors
Your Nexlayer connection is personal to your account. You can review or revoke access anytime in Settings.
Workspace controls (Business/Enterprise)
Admins can manage which MCP servers are available to all users via Settings → Privacy & security.
Troubleshooting
Can't add custom MCP server?
Custom MCP servers require a paid Lovable plan. Check your subscription in Settings → Billing.
Authorization failed?
Make sure you have a Nexlayer account. If the OAuth flow fails, try removing and re-adding the connector.
Server not responding?
Verify the server URL is exactly https://mcp.nexlayer.ai/api/mcp with no trailing slash.
